What is Google Analytics?

Google Analytics is a free service provided by Google which gives detailed statistics to webmasters (and it works very well for hubbers too). With Google Analytics tracking your hubpages you will be able to find out lots of information, such as:

  • How many visitors (both unique and repeat) you are getting to each hub
  • Where in the world your visitors come from
  • How people get to your hubs (e.g. from a search engine or by clicking a link)
  • Which keywords they use to get to your hubs
  • How long they spend looking at each hub

...and lots lots more - but we'll stick to the basics for now.

Why use Google Analytics?

Why use Google Analytics when you can already get stats on Hubpages?

The stats produced by Google Analytics are much more detailed than the ones Hubpages give you.  Also, looking at the key phrases which have been used to find your hub will give you ideas for writing other related hubs. Personally I find it fascinating to see which countries my visitors are accessing my site from. It's also interesting to note the times in the week (or over the year for some hubs) which get the most visitors. The screenshot above shows a hub which experiences a dip in traffic every weekend.

How to start using Google Analytics

  1. If you haven't already got one, you will need to get yourself a Google Account.
  2. Sign in to your Google Account (go to Google and click Sign In top right).
  3. Click My Account (top right), then click the link for Analytics.
  4. Click Analytics Settings (top left), then Add Website Profile (bottom left).
  5. Type in hubpages.com and click continue. Don't worry, you won't be tracking all of hubpages.com content, just the pages with your unique tracking ID in them.

  6. A text box containing JavaScript code will be produced. People who have created their own websites would have to copy all this code into their pages, but Hubpages handles all that for you - all you need to do is look through the code and find your unique Tracking ID, which will look something like this: UA-123456-7. Select and copy this code (hold down Ctrl and press C).

  7. Now go to your Hubpages account and click Affiliate Settings. Paste your Google Analytics tracking code into the box labelled Analytics (not the box labelled Google - that's for your Adsense ID) and click to update.

Completing the Google Analytics Setup

When you have entered the tracking code on your Hubpages account, you will need to go back to Google Analytics.

Click the Finish button on the page showing the tracking code. Your hubpage should be listed with a message alongside inviting you to check the status of the tracking code. When you've checked the status and the code is found, you should get the "Waiting for data" message.

It can be quite a long wait...it can take up to 24 hours for the stats to be updated, so don't wait up!

Using Google Analytics for multiple Hubpages

I've been using Google Analytics to track some of my websites for quite a while now, and I was initially confused about how it would work with multiple hubs. I thought I would need a different tracking code for each hub and there didn't seem to be anywhere to enter multiple codes. I decided then that maybe only overall stats would be produced, rather than for individual hubs. But I was wrong! I couldn't work out how to do it, so I gave up. And guess what? It just happened all by itself. Hubpages are so clever. Once you have entered your Google Analytics Tracking ID in your affiliate settings, ALL of your hubs will be automatically tracked and you will be able to access overall stats as well as stats for individual hubs.

Google Analytics Dashboard

Once Google Analytics has started collecting data from your hubpages, you will see the stats summarised on the Dashboard when you visit Google Analytics (see screenshot at the top of this page).

There is a wealth of information just in this first screen, but there is plenty more to find when you explore.

Content Overview

The content overview panel appears at the bottom right hand corner of the Analytics dashboard. This is probably the most important section for hubbers. It will list all your hubs (or if you have too many to show in the panel, just click "view report" to see them all).

Clicking any of the hub URLs in the content overview panel will provide detailed stats for the individual hub.

Visits Graph

The graph at the top of the Google Analytics dashboard shows the number of visitors over a period of time (you can easily change the date range).

Map Overlay

The map overlay shows where in the world your visitors have come from (darker areas have most visitors). You can click "view report" to get much more detail.

Traffic Sources Overview

The traffic sources overview shows how much of your traffic came from a search engine, the number of visits referred from other sites and how many accessed directly. Again, you can click "view report" to find out more.
